Wike commiserates with Ortom over younger brother’s death

 

By Ben Adoga, Abuja

Minister of the Federal Capital Territory, Nyesom Wike, has commiserated with the immediate past Governor of Benue State, Samuel Ortom, over the death of his younger brother, Mr Bernard Tyozenda Ortom.

In a statement yesterday by his Senior Special Assistant on Public Communications and Social Media, Lere Olayinka, the FCT Minister, who described the death of Bernard Tyozenda Ortom as painful, prayed for the repose of his soul.

He urged former Governor Ortom and the entire Ortom Adorogo family of Guma Local Government Area of Benue State to remain strong and take solace in God, the giver and taker of life.

The Minister said, “The news of Mr Bernard Tyozenda Ortom Nicholas’s death came to me as a rude shock, and I understand the feeling of loss that must be going on in the mind of my brother and friend, His Excellency Dr Samuel Ortom now.

“However, as painful and shocking as the death may be, I urged that solace should be taken in God, who has made death inevitable.

“On behalf of my family, friends and associates, I commiserate with you over this sad incident. I pray that God, in His infinite mercies, will give you and the entire Ortom Adorogo family the fortitude to bear this irreparable and painful loss.

Sixty-two-year-old Bernard Orton, who died on March 19, will be buried on April 3 in his home town, Gbajimba in Guma Local Government Area of Benue State.
